-
2025-10-02 22:11:02
- 云原生中的服务网格如何实现服务配置?
- 服务网格通过控制平面与数据平面协同,实现服务发现、流量管理、安全认证等配置的集中化与自动化。Sidecar代理从控制平面获取服务端点与路由规则,集成Kubernetes机制实时更新拓扑,支持多集群跨命名空间发现;通过VirtualService和DestinationRule声明式配置灰度发布、负载均衡等策略,经xDS协议热更新至数据平面;mTLS自动加密通信,Citadel或Istiod负责证书轮换,AuthorizationPolicy基于ServiceAccount实施细粒度访问控制;配置
-
360
-
2025-10-03 08:26:02
- 微服务中的服务网格如何实现服务发现负载均衡?
- 服务网格通过数据平面与控制平面协作,实现服务发现与负载均衡的基础设施化。服务实例启动后向控制平面注册,边车代理从控制平面同步实例列表,实现透明化服务发现;支持多注册源兼容。边车代理在L4/L7层执行负载均衡,提供轮询、最少请求等算法,结合健康检查、熔断、重试提升调用成功率。控制平面如IstioPilot统一配置下发,通过CRD定义路由规则,支持灰度发布、动态更新,策略秒级生效。开发者专注业务逻辑,运维获得更强控制力,虽增加代理开销,但大规模微服务场景收益显著。
-
142
-
2025-10-03 09:44:02
- 如何使用 Playwright 对 .NET 微服务进行 E2E 测试?
- Playwright主要用于验证.NET微服务的HTTP接口和前端界面,通过模拟用户行为或客户端调用测试ASP.NETCore应用、RESTAPI、认证流程及多服务协作;测试前需启动服务并等待就绪,可使用TypeScript编写自动化测试用例,通过page.request发送请求并断言结果,结合@playwright/test组织测试逻辑,并集成至CI/CD流程,在GitHubActions等环境中自动构建、运行服务与测试,实现端到端质量保障。
-
458
-
2025-10-03 10:11:02
- rabbitmq 中 vhost 的作用是什么?
- vhost是RabbitMQ中实现多租户和权限隔离的核心机制,通过创建多个虚拟主机,实现用户间资源、权限和环境的完全隔离。每个vhost拥有独立的队列、交换机和绑定关系,支持不同应用或团队在单一RabbitMQ实例上安全共存。可通过rabbitmqctl命令或Web管理界面创建和管理vhost,并为用户分配对应权限。虽然vhost对吞吐量直接影响较小,但过多vhost或不当配置会增加系统开销,需合理规划数量以平衡隔离性与性能。
-
953
-
2025-10-03 11:43:02
- 微服务架构中的事件溯源模式是什么?
- 事件溯源模式通过记录状态变化为不可变事件序列来管理业务逻辑,每次操作追加事件而非修改数据,支持状态回放与审计。常用于金融交易、订单流程等需高可追溯性的微服务场景,多与CQRS结合,使用Kafka或EventStoreDB存储事件,提升系统透明性与调试能力,但增加复杂性与版本管理难度。
-
158
-
2025-10-03 12:41:02
- XML与Excel如何互转?常用方法有哪些?
- Excel转XML可通过内置功能导出或另存为XML表格文件;2.XML转Excel可直接打开或用PowerQuery导入;3.编程可用Python、Java、C#实现批量处理;4.在线工具适合小文件转换。应根据数据量、复杂度和自动化需求选择方法,确保结构清晰与字段正确映射。
-
858
-
2025-10-03 12:44:01
- 什么是 Kubernetes 的 Pod 拓扑扩展约束?
- Kubernetes的Pod拓扑扩展约束可实现Pod在节点或可用区间的均衡分布,通过配置maxSkew、topologyKey、whenUnsatisfiable和labelSelector字段,确保高可用与容错,适用于多副本应用的稳定部署。
-
624
-
2025-10-03 13:43:02
- ASP.NET Core 中的模型绑定器提供程序如何自定义?
- 先实现自定义IModelBinder处理绑定逻辑,再通过IModelBinderProvider按条件选择该绑定器,最后在Program.cs中注册提供程序并用[ModelBinder]特性指定使用,从而实现对string类型参数的全局自定义绑定,如将输入值前缀加工返回。
-
579
-
2025-10-03 14:35:02
- 云原生中的服务网格如何实现服务健康传播?
- 服务网格通过边车代理与控制平面协同实现健康状态的自动化闭环管理。边车代理基于健康检查策略探测服务状态,上报数据并影响本地路由;控制平面汇总信息生成全局视图,动态更新服务发现列表,并通过xDS协议下发端点信息;系统据此执行智能流量调度,优先调用健康实例,结合熔断、重试与灰度发布策略,提升整体稳定性和自愈能力,全过程对应用透明。
-
868
-
2025-10-03 15:20:02